Are you a Minty Maiden or a Virgin Mary?
Whether you’re heading out to the bar for a night with the girls, or with work colleagues, it appears that an increasing number of women are choosing not to drink. Whilst the old faithful excuses of ‘I’m driving’ or ‘I’m pregnant!’ are still applicable, more women are simply choosing not to drink ‘just because’ – no excuse necessary.The ramifications of excessive drinking are consistently being brought to our attention, especially the health, social, and economic problems arising from such behaviour. A recent Scottish Government paper estimated that 30% of women – a figure that is in decline – regularly exceeded the recommended alcohol limit of 14 units per week, with the most frequent offenders being women from managerial or professional working households. That’s easy enough to understand; most of us have, at one point, probably finished off a long day at work, headed home, kicked off the heels, and poured out a nice relaxing glass of wine. Before you know it, the bottle is empty – oops!
So what about dodging temptation and choosing not to drink – how easy is it to do really, especially when you’re out on the town? I won’t lie; if you’re a regular drinker the decision not to drink can take a bit of will-power, especially when the first round of drinks are being ordered. Get past this first hurdle of temptation successfully, and you’ll be fine for the rest of the night.

The best part of choosing not to drink comes the morning after. Thanks to all the fruit-based cocktails, it is a refreshing change not to be greeted by a dull, throbbing head, dark circles under the eyes and pasty skin. Not only will you look fabulous, you will also be able to remember everything from your evening, dodging that horrible sinking moment when an unwelcome recollection floats into the memory. With so many benefits, maybe we should all opt for a drink free night out at least once a month – you never know, they could become addictive!
